Final Day of NYS Aerial Operations Course Held at Rockland Fire Training Center

This past weekend marked the conclusion of the New York State Aerial Operations course at the Rockland County Fire Training Center. Over several weeks, students dedicated a total of 45 hours to intensive, hands-on training in operating aerial apparatus.

The course covered everything from setup procedures to critical safety protocols, equipping participants with the skills needed to effectively and safely operate ladder trucks during emergency responses. Each session featured three to four ladder trucks from various local fire departments, offering students the opportunity to work with different equipment — a key component in fostering mutual aid and interdepartmental coordination.
